Overview
- The brawl, which broke out on Sunday in upper-deck section 518 at Guaranteed Rate Field, involved more than a dozen people and lasted for over two minutes.
- Multiple viral clips show a fan jumping down several rows and appearing to stomp or 'drop-kick' a spectator, escalating the melee.
- Ushers and security moved in carrying handcuffs and eventually separated participants while many bystanders filmed the scene.
- Reports so far do not confirm serious injuries or any arrests related to the Rate Field incident, and venue or law-enforcement statements have not been detailed in coverage.
- The episode follows a separate Wrigley Field brawl earlier in the week and could prompt renewed scrutiny of stadium crowd control as social media amplifies footage and public concern.
